Tenant Improvements Plans and Specifications definition

Tenant Improvements Plans and Specifications means the plans and Specifications" for the construction of the Tenant Improvements, which plans and specifications shall be prepared pursuant to Exhibit C attached hereto.
Tenant Improvements Plans and Specifications means the plans and specifications for the construction of the Tenant Improvements, which plans and specifications shall be prepared pursuant to Exhibit D attached hereto.

Tenant Improvements Plans and Specifications means collectively the "Preliminary Plans and Specifications," the "Tenant Improvements Schematic Design Drawings," the "Tenant Improvements Design Development Drawings", the "Tenant Improvements Construction Drawings" (all as defined herein), and all related plans, drawings, specifications and notes. The Tenant Improvements Plans and Specifications shall be prepared by Landlord in compliance with all Applicable Land Use Laws and Regulations.
Tenant Improvements Plans and Specifications means the final plans and specifications for the Tenant Improvements, as the same may be established and modified in accordance with the Work Letter. For avoidance of doubt, the Tenant Improvements Plans and Specifications are the same as the “Tenant Construction Documents Issued for Construction,” developed in accordance with the Work Letter.
Tenant Improvements Plans and Specifications means the plans and specifications for the construction of the Tenant Improvements, which plans and specifications are reasonably approved by Landlord and Tenant and included in one or more Lease addendums to be considered a part hereof.
Tenant Improvements Plans and Specifications means the plans and specifications and other information prepared or to be prepared by Tenant’s Architect and, to the extent necessary, Landlord’s mechanical, electrical and HVAC engineers, necessary for the construction of the Tenant Improvements.
